Nokia again ranked No. 1 for mobile core portfolio competitiveness by Omdia

Nokia has again taken the top spot in Omdia’s Market Landscape: Core Vendors report. This is the second year in a row that Nokia ranked No. 1 for mobile core portfolio competitiveness.
Omdia evaluated 12 vendors in its 2026 report. Nokia was named a leader in all seven categories.
These include portfolio breadth, cloud-native maturity, signaling, automation, Core as a Service, AI/ML and analytics, and other network function implementations.
The result comes as operators continue to modernize their core networks. Cloud-native platforms, automation and AI are becoming increasingly important.
Nokia has been expanding its portfolio in these areas. Recent deployments include 5G Core SaaS, Core SaaS Edge and network resilience solutions. The company is also involved in core modernization projects for telecom operators and mission-critical networks.
Omdia gave greater weight to AI/ML and analytics in the 2026 report. This reflects their growing role in network automation, efficiency and service development.
For Nokia, the ranking is another strong result for a business that sits mostly behind the scenes. Nokia may still be best known by many for phones, but its network infrastructure business remains one of the industry’s major players.
